    It has not been a very long wait for Noah Baumbach's latest movie because the last one (While We're Young) was released last April. This one features another fine performance by Greta Gerwig as an uber-energetic damsel whose approach to life is to meet it head-on as did Auntie Mame except Gerwig's Brooke is less grounded. Brooke is appealing in her often misdirected and unfocused enthusiasm for a myriad of projects ("I'd like to get into the App business") Tracy, an aspiring writer, is fascinated with Brooke and writes about her in veiled but revealing fashion much to the chagrin of her new "sister". Much comedy ensues throughout in this modest effort by the director of The Squid and the Whale (2005)
